Getting ready for Your Visit
Prior to you head to your initial appointment with a cataract specialist, it's important to collect vital info and prepare yourself.
Start by making a listing of your signs and symptoms and any kind of inquiries you want to ask. Note any type of drugs you're currently taking, including non-prescription drugs and supplements, as this details is crucial for your specialist.
Bring along your case history, specifically details concerning previous eye problems or surgeries. It's additionally a good concept to have somebody accompany you, as they can help remember what's talked about.
Finally, prepare yourself mentally for the visit by understanding that the cosmetic surgeon will certainly clarify your choices and may suggest examinations to assess your condition. Being organized will make the experience smoother and extra efficient.
Assessments and Assessments
When you come to your appointment, the cataract surgeon will perform a series of assessments and assessments to review your eye health and wellness.
You'll begin with a vision test to determine the clearness of your sight. The surgeon might also use specialized instruments to check for cataracts and evaluate their intensity.
Anticipate to go through a complete eye assessment, including measuring your eye pressure and checking out the shape of your cornea. Extension decreases may be provided to enable a better sight of the lens and retina.
Throughout this process, do not wait to ask questions or reveal problems; it is necessary that you completely comprehend what's occurring.
These evaluations are critical for customizing the best strategy to your cataract therapy.
